E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
-------连通图
斯坦纳树入门
概述斯坦纳树用于解决最优化
连通图
问题。即选择权值和最小的边集,使某些关键点连通。斯坦纳树使用状压DP,设状态f[i][S]表示结点i与关键点集合S连通的答案。
myjs999
·
2020-08-21 00:41
2017-2018 ACM-ICPC, Asia Daejeon Regional Contest 题解(GYM 101667)
还是按通过人数从高到低做.韩文题解http://blog.myungwoo.kr/121(有代码)这个比赛的榜,170分钟就有队ak了….DHappyNumber水题,先操作一次即可.CGameMap在无向
连通图
上找一点序列
Little_Fall
·
2020-08-21 00:56
题解
NOI2018 归程
题目大意%给出一个nnn个点,mmm条边的无向
连通图
,每条边上有两个参数l,al,al,a。其中lll表示边的长度,aaa表示边的海拔(即高度)。
linjiayang2016
·
2020-08-21 00:40
Kruscal重构树
双搜其实并不难
根据我的理解,搜索就是根据某种扩展规则,从某一个(
连通图
)或几个(非
连通图
)点(或状态)开始,遍历所有可能达到的点(或状态),简单来说就是遍历所有状态,找出其中的可行解(或最优解)。
slicer
·
2020-08-20 23:59
搜索
语言/理论
搜索
双向BFS
Luogu2619[国家集训队2] Tree I
原题链接:https://www.luogu.org/problemnew/show/P2619TreeI题目描述给你一个无向带权
连通图
,每条边是黑色或白色。
ShadyPi
·
2020-08-20 22:49
图论===========
MST
Kruscal
杂============
二分
LOJ#3323. 「SNOI2020」生成树
题目描述给定无向
连通图
GGG,已知GGG在删掉一条边后是一颗仙人掌(仙人掌:不存在两个拥有公共边的简单环的无向联通图),求GGG的生成树个数。
Master.Yi
·
2020-08-20 22:33
[BZOJ2001][Hnoi2010]City 城市建设(CDQ分治+并查集)
和AHOI2013
连通图
差不多,但仿佛还要恶心……基本思想是CDQ分治往下递归时,不断地缩小图的规模。下面考虑怎样处理[l,r][l,r]范围内的操作。
xyz32768
·
2020-08-20 22:29
BZOJ
UOJ
LOJ
深度优先搜索(DFS)详解
深度优先搜索(DFS)【算法入门】1.前言深度优先搜索(缩写DFS)有点类似广度优先搜索,也是对一个
连通图
进行遍历的算法。
LzyRapX
·
2020-08-20 21:10
ACM_搜索
深度优先搜索
DFS详解
neuoj1575树的存在性(置换变循环
https://oj.neu.edu.cn/problem/1507题意:给定一个1到N的排列P_1到P_N,请判断是否存在一个由N个点,N-1条边构成的无向
连通图
,满足对于任意两个整数i和j(1usingnamespacestd
ddb21246
·
2020-08-20 21:33
图论(八)可平面图
文章目录可平面性可平面图图着色镶嵌应用场地布局运筹学的场地布局,印刷电路板设计可平面性可平面的:能将图在平面画出且不相交单圈图:仅包含一个圈的
连通图
交叉数:最小交叉次数如果A是不可平面的,一定有子图B也是不可平面的对于
努力成为程序媛鸭
·
2020-08-20 16:37
algorithm
【梳理】离散数学 第15章 欧拉图与哈密顿图 15.1 欧拉图 15.2 哈密顿图
2、无向图G是欧拉图,当且仅当G是
连通图
且没有奇度顶点。证明若G为平凡图,显然成立。设该图G(V,E)为非平凡
山上一缕烟
·
2020-08-20 14:42
基础课
#
离散数学
图的应用:最小生成树 最短路径 拓扑排序 关键路径
最小生成树最短路径拓扑排序关键路径最小生成树生成树➢一个图可以有许多棵不同的生成树image.png➢所有生成树具有以下共同特点生成树的顶点个数与图的顶点个数相同;生成树是图的极小连通子图,去掉一条边则非连通;一个有n个顶点的
连通图
的生成树有
兜兜_2925
·
2020-08-20 14:32
数据结构与算法--图论之寻找连通分量、强连通分量
数据结构与算法--图论之寻找连通分量、强连通分量寻找无向图的连通分量使用深度优先搜索可以很简单地找出一幅图的所有连通分量,回忆
连通图
的概念:如果从任意顶点都存在一条路径达到任意一个顶点,则称这幅图是
连通图
weixin_30628077
·
2020-08-20 13:51
最小生成树详细讲解(一看就懂!) & kruskal算法
满脸疑惑一个有n个结点的
连通图
的生成树是原图的极小连通子图,且包含原图中的所有n个结点,并且有保持图连通的最少的边——源自百度百科在一给定的无向图G=(V,E)中
weixin_30451709
·
2020-08-20 13:10
数据结构与算法
【算法导论】最小生成树之Kruskal法
在图论中,树是指无回路存在的
连通图
。一个
连通图
的生成树是指包含了所有顶点的树。如果把生成树的边的权值总和作为生成树的权,那么权值最小的生成树就称为最小生成树。
nineheaded_bird
·
2020-08-20 13:56
C/C++
算法
算法之道
《C语言-数据结构篇章》-求
连通图
的分量》
无向图的的连通分量较为简单,只需要在深度优先遍历的时候,作一个记录就行。深度搜索算法,就是利用递归的性质来做的。voiddfs(graphy*gra)//递归遍历{intk=0;for(inti=1;inode_number;i++){if(visted[i-1]==0)//用来判断是否已经访问过了//注意这个地方是关键,如果各个分量都连通//则只会执行一次,如果不连通回会回来后i++//此时就出
好先生·
·
2020-08-20 13:13
C语言-数据结构
Tree Cutting HDU - 5909(树形DP+FWT优化)
TreeCutting题目链接:HDU-5909题意:有一个
连通图
,n个点,n-1条边(就是一棵树),每个节点有一个权值,一棵树的价值是其节点(包括本身及其子节点)的权值的异或和;求价值为[0,m)的树有多少颗
LBJHan
·
2020-08-20 11:41
怒刷DP
数据结构 第六章 图 作业(已批改)
判断题1-1无向
连通图
至少有一个顶点的度为1。
爆爆爆爆要抱抱
·
2020-08-20 10:02
数据结构
数据结构之图-连通分量
如果图中任意两个顶点之间都连通,则称该图为
连通图
,否则,称该图为非
连通图
,则其中的极大连通子图称为连通分量,这里所谓的极大是指子图中包含的顶点个数极大。
机器不学习_
·
2020-08-20 10:53
算法合集
(1小时数据结构)数据结构c++描述(二十八)--- 图(强连通分量)
应为也是一个图,所以也是
连通图
。此图,所有用灰色标记的就是对应的连通分量,{1},{0,2,3,4,5},{6},{7,8},{9,10,11,12}.在有
比卡丘不皮
·
2020-08-20 10:35
数据结构与算法
(1小时数据结构)数据结构c++描述(二十九)--- 图(最小生成树)
最小代价生成树:一个无向
连通图
的生成树是一个极小连通子图,它包括图中全部顶点,并且有尽可能少的边。遍历一个
连通图
得到图的一棵生成树。
比卡丘不皮
·
2020-08-20 10:35
数据结构与算法
数据结构
c++
算法
Kruskal
prim
[bfs+图上随机游走] hdu6853 jogging
所以我们只用bfs求出整张
连通图
,算出s
kosf_
·
2020-08-20 09:38
美团2019秋招笔试—图的遍历
题目:思路:N个节点,N-1个边,且无向
连通图
,每次从1开始遍历,说明是生成树;则最长的边遍历一次,其他的边遍历两次,则能使得路程最短;首先求得最大深度m,然后就可以得到路程m+(N-1-m)*2;代码
wwwsctvcom
·
2020-08-20 04:32
笔试记录
Codeforces 1307D - Cow and Fields【最短路+思维转换】
题目: 给出一个nnn个点,mmm条边的无向
连通图
,其中有kkk个特殊的点。选择连接这kkk个点中的两个,使得从111号点到nnn号的最短距离最大化,并求出该最短距离。
xzx9
·
2020-08-20 04:06
codeforces
[二维并查集/强
连通图
]hdu 1269 迷宫城堡
hdu1269迷宫城堡题意:给出数个点的有向图,求是否任意两点间互通,也就是强
连通图
判断思路:一开始是想,从第一个点dfs搜索所有点,再所有点搜索第一个点,感觉会超时,没写出来……然后看了下dalao的题解
soundwave_
·
2020-08-20 03:36
数学方法
并查集
蓝桥杯第十一届省模拟赛题目java组
1.一个包含有2019个结点的无向
连通图
,最少包含多少条边?
qqcoming
·
2020-08-20 03:22
蓝桥杯基础算法
最小生成树 学习笔记(prim + kruskal)
概念生成树:一个
连通图
含有全部nnn个顶点,但只有足以构成一棵树的n−1n-1n−1条边。一颗n个顶点的生成树有且仅有n−1n-1n−1条边,如果生成树当中再添加一条边,必定成环。
cqbz_luoyiran
·
2020-08-20 03:07
生成树
图论
codeforce266D 最短路
//给你一个无向
连通图
,找一个点使得它到这个图最短路中最大的距离最短//可以遍历所有边,对于每条边有的连个顶点u,v//可以通过这两个点将这个图分左边,u-v边,右边三个部分//但是哪些点分在左边,哪些点分在右边
ijbuhv
·
2020-08-20 03:18
最短路
codeforces1307D 1900分最短路
题目传送门题意:n个点m条边的无向
连通图
,边权都是1。起点是第1个点,终点是第n个点。有k个特殊点,你必须在原图上添加一条边,这条边连接两个关键点。问你从起点到终点最短路的最大值是多少。数据范围:。
敲代码的欧文
·
2020-08-20 03:47
#
最短路
CodeForces - 1307D Cow and Fields 最短路
CodeForces-1307DCowandFields最短路题意:给出n个点m条边的
连通图
,给出k个关键点的编号,以两个关键点连边,问从1到n的最短路最大是多少现假设:d1[i]d1[i]d1[i]表示从
w_uxidixi
·
2020-08-20 02:25
Codeforces
最短路问题
数据结构回顾及展望(二)(3.22更新)
----------引言预备知识(默认已掌握)
连通图
:在无向图中,若任意两个顶点与都有路径相通,则称该无向图为
连通图
。强
连通图
:在有向图中,若任意两个顶点与都有路径相通,则称该有向图为强
连通图
。
菱形继承
·
2020-08-20 02:40
#
面向过程编程
#
Data
Structure
python二级选择题错题集(一)
正确答案答案解析文章目录1.一个算法一般具有的特征2.下列几个排序中,要求内存量最大的是:3.线性表的顺序存储结构和线性表的链式存储结构分别是:4.单链表中,增加头节点的目的:5.算法分析的目的:6.n个顶点的强
连通图
的边数至少为
我是小杨我就这样
·
2020-08-20 02:31
计算机二级python等级考试
最小生成树
在一个
连通图
中,从一个节点出发,试图找到一种连接方式,使得连接所有节点的边的权重总和是最小的。这样的问题就可以通过最小生成树来解决,它能保证从一个特定的节点出发连接整个
连通图
节点的边权重的和是最小的。
vamesary
·
2020-08-19 20:01
java
基础算法
0092 经典算法系列——泛洪填充(FloodFill)
泛洪填充(FloodFill)问题在图像处理中非常常用,它和
连通图
的概念相似。
gendlee1991
·
2020-08-19 15:25
Algorithm
详解欧拉图
欧拉图一、定义概念欧拉通路设G是
连通图
(无向的或有向的).G中经过每条边一次并且仅一次的通路称作欧拉通路欧拉回路若G中的欧拉通路又是回路,则称它为G中的欧拉回路欧拉图具有欧拉回路的图称欧拉图二、判定定理
亿念之茶
·
2020-08-19 10:12
最小生成树-Prim算法详解(含全部代码)
目录适用条件测试所用图算法详解Prim算法代码全部代码实验结果适用条件加权
连通图
测试所用图所用原图及生成过程其中,(a)为原图,圆圈里面是节点的名称,边上的数字是边的权值。
lady_killer9
·
2020-08-19 10:49
常见算法与数据结构实现
图
树
复杂网络(2)--图论的基本理论-最小生成树问题
连通图
G=(V,E),每条边上有非负权L(e)。一棵树上所有树枝上权的总和,称为这个生成树的权。具有最小权的生成树称为最小生成树(minimum
追蜗牛的coder
·
2020-08-19 10:30
最小生成树之 prim算法、kruskal算法(详细分析)
生成树:一个
连通图
含有图中全部nnn个顶点,但只有足以构成一棵树的n−1n-1n−1条边。一颗有nnn个顶点的生成树有且仅有n−1n-1n−1条边,如果生成树中再添加一条边,则必成环。
cqbz_lanziming
·
2020-08-19 09:10
最小生成树
算法
c++
图论
NOIP 2014 联合权值
描述无向
连通图
G有n个点,n-1条边。点从1到n依次编号,编号为i的点的权值为Wi,每条边的长度均为1。图上两点(u,v)的距离定义为u点到v点的最短距离。
我要吃熊猫
·
2020-08-19 09:52
模拟
<===图论===>
割点 桥 极大连通子图(双连通分支)
重
连通图
:一个没有割点的图称为是重
连通图
。在重
连通图
上,任意一对顶点之间至少存在两条路径,则在删去某个顶点以及依附于该顶点的各边时也不破坏图的连通性。
YDYKL
·
2020-08-19 08:06
其他
算法
存储
hdu 3018Ant Trip(一笔画问题,用并查集就无向图的连通分量)
2.思路:①先用并查集求出有几个连通分量;②如果连通分量中只有一个结点,那么就是0笔画;③在一个简单无向
连通图
中,如果没有欧拉回路,至少要用n/2笔画画完所有边,n是奇点个数。
xky1306102chenhong
·
2020-08-19 07:14
ACM
Floyd模板题 P1704
Description给出N个顶点,M条无向带权边的
连通图
,和Q个查询:请编程回答:问1、两点之间的最短路径(边权和最小的路径);问2、两点之间的所有路径中,需要经过的最小边的最大的路径(最大边最小);
weixin_30555125
·
2020-08-19 07:27
联合权值(codevs 3728)题解
【问题描述】无向
连通图
G有n个点,n-1条边。点从1到n依次编号,编号为i的点的权值为Wi,每条边的长度均为1。图上两点(u,v)的距离定义为u点到v点的最短距离。
baijian9657
·
2020-08-19 06:55
P2819 图的m着色问题 洛谷
pid=2819题目背景给定无向
连通图
G和m种不同的颜色。用这些颜色为图G的各顶点着色,每个顶点着一种颜色。如果有一种着色法使G中每条边的2个顶点着不同颜色,则称这个图是m可着色的。
agcozdwdfvds08078
·
2020-08-19 06:15
图的最小支撑树
支撑树:
连通图
G的某一无环连通子图T若能覆盖G中所有顶点,则称T为G的一棵支撑树或生成树。最小支撑树:若图G为一带权网络,则每一棵支撑树的成本为其所拥有的各边的权重的总和。
wjiaman
·
2020-08-19 05:37
数据结构
东北大学——考研初试——计算机842——图非编程题
图的定义有向图、无向图弧、边、顶点简单图不存在重复边不存在顶点到自身的边完全图有向图n个顶点,n(n-1)个弧无向图n个顶点,n(n-1)/2个边连通、连通分量、
连通图
无向图连通:存在i到j的路径连通分量
CalmFireVV
·
2020-08-19 02:20
图
out-Degree),入度(in-Degree)树(Tree),森林(Forest),环(Loop)有向图(DirectedGraph),无向图(UndirectedGraph),完全有向图,完全无向图
连通图
三月凌空
·
2020-08-18 22:45
java
算法
克鲁斯卡尔(Kruskal)算法(K算法):公交站问题
,比如A-B为12公里如何修路保证各个站点都能走通,并距离最短从图和问题可以看出,克鲁斯卡尔算法与普里姆算法解决的问题完成一致,只是解决问题的方式不同2,克鲁斯卡尔算法介绍克鲁斯卡尔算法,是用来求加权
连通图
的最小生成树的算法基本算法思想
传说中的靖哥哥
·
2020-08-18 22:04
数据结构&算法
Java写无向图的基于DFS的最小生成树算法
最小生成树:一个有n个结点的
连通图
的生成树是原图的极小连通子图,且包含原图中的所有n个结点,并且有保持图连通的最少的边。无向图的最小生成树比较简单。
IT独白者
·
2020-08-18 16:38
Java与数据结构
POJ 1386 有向图欧拉通路
当然还得考虑一下这个图是否是
连通图
,这里可以用并查集记录边的集合。最后判断是否是一个
连通图
。欧拉通路水题。#include#include#include#inc
kdqzzxxcc
·
2020-08-18 08:24
图论
上一页
14
15
16
17
18
19
20
21
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他